  • Trump Advisers Took Advantage of Navarro’s Absence to Push for Tariff Pause

    04/19/2025 5:22:50 AM PDT · by karpov · 29 replies
    Wall Street Journal ^ | April 18, 2025 | Alexander Saeedy and Josh Dawsey
    They needed to get the president alone. On April 9, financial markets were going haywire.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ent and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ick wanted President Trump to put a pause on his aggressive global tariff plan. But there was a big obstacle: Peter Navarro, Trump’s tariff-loving trade adviser, who was constantly hovering around the Oval Office. Navarro isn’t one to back down during policy debates and had stridently urged Trump to keep tariffs in place, even as corporate chieftains and other advisers urged him to relent.   • Peter Navarro, ex-Trump trade adviser, released from prison

    07/17/2024 6:56:18 AM PDT · by Red Badger · 14 replies
    CBS News ^ | JULY 17, 2024 | Melissa Quinn
    Washington — Peter Navarro, who served as a top trade adviser to former President Donald Trump, was released from federal prison on Wednesday after serving a four-month sentence for defying a congressional subpoena, according to the Federal Bureau of Prisons. Navarro, 75, reported in March to serve his sentence at the federal correctional institute in Miami and was assigned to an 80-person dormitory for older inmates. He is listed among the speakers at this week's Republican National Convention in Milwaukee, though it's unclear whether he will address attendees Wednesday or Thursday, the final day of the event.
